I feel I should start by saying I love Michael Palin's works, from film, TV to travel literature. That is why I feel slightly disappointed by his diaries. They were interesting for an insight into Python's workings and how Pailn worked during the seventies, but they did begin to drag awfully. There are only so many Python meetings, or film recordings one can read about before getting a little bored by them. Saying that, there are some fascinating anecdotes, as well as touching moments with his family. I especially liked when they climb up inside the Statue of Liberty and look forward to reaching her underwear! If you love Palin, or Python, then this book is worth a go, otherwise I'd say you could give it a miss and not worry too much.

The first thing that struck me when this arrived was how thick the book was (700+ pages), the second was how similar his diaries are (in tone) to most of his television work. He doesn't sound much different (even at 20) than he does today! The diaries read like an extra-long version of his travel series (as he comments on Python and the seventies with the same laid back charm and erudite wit we've come to know him for).

It is true, that there is a lot of repetition (as another reviewer has mentioned, there are countless Python meetings etc.), but I've saved this for reading in chunks on holiday so it has never really been a problem. I suppose that if you read it in one go like a book, then it may well become a little tiresome. For putting in your suitcase and dipping into each time you go away over a couple of years (or even back home when you feel like a "holiday" read), though, it is the perfect summer travelling companion.
